Location
The Ehemalige Hofkapelle Sankt Luzia is situated at Isseler Hof in Schweich, Germany.
History
This chapel was constructed in the 18th century and served as a place of worship for the local community. Its architectural style reflects the Baroque period, characterized by ornate decorations and intricate details.
